CHANGELOG 2.9.0 — Crumbline order service. Changed default order-cutoff rule: weekday cutoff moved from 18:00 to 16:00 shop-local time, and same-day custom cakes now rejected after cutoff instead of queued. Migration backfills existing shop overrides; shops without overrides inherit the new defaults. Rollback requires restoring the prior rule set. The new default configuration is as follows.

config for kafof-bawef:
holath:
  log_level: debug
  metrics_host: metrics.holath.qorvelsys.internal
  pin: 2191
  pool_size: 32

## Welcome to QueueScale

Hey! QueueScale is our queue-depth autoscaler — it watches backlog on the Birchline job queues and spins workers up or down. As a contractor you'll mostly touch the scaling policies, which are plain YAML in the policies repo. Golden rule: never set min replicas to zero on the billing queue, we learned that the hard way. Staging creds come from the Tooling team. If you get stuck or need access sorted, drop a note to the team inbox below.

escalation mailbox, bafog-fafog: ulador@paliqlabs.internal

Subject: Morvane term sheet — status

Branch managers: Morvane Holdings returned the term sheet with two changes. Exclusivity narrowed to the Delby corridor; payment terms moved to net-45. Both acceptable. Signing targeted for month-end. Do not discuss with partners or staff until then. Branch-level impacts will follow after execution. The strategic reasoning is set out in the note below.

confidential, kagup-bafog: Fraaxax Group is in early talks to buy Soroxox Group for about $343.8 million. The Olidor launch date is June 14, and nothing goes to the press before then. Legal wants the Aldmirek Logistics term sheet signed before July 23.